Composition of Metal Plastic

 

WEICON Plastic Metals are two-component epoxy resin based. They are supplied in packages containing resin and reagent in the correct mixing ratio. Depending on the type, the resin is filled with steel or aluminium or in some cases with a mineral component (except for the MS 1000 Castable Resin). The different type of reagent determines the viscosity and polymerisation behaviour of each type.

 

Plastic metal: characteristics

After mixing the two components, WEICON Plastic Metal hardens at room temperature and becomes metal-like, adhering to almost all types of surfaces. The curing time depends on the type. Plastic Metal: Polymerisation and Treatment

Depending on the type, WEICON Plastic Metals can be machined or removed from the mould after 2 hours up to a maximum of 24 hours at room temperature.

 

Final polymerisation is reached for all types after 48 hours at room temperature.*

 

In cold environments, curing can be accelerated with heat, max. 40°C (lamps, electric blankets, hot fan). Do not use an open flame (gas burners or oil lamps) to avoid overheating and possible deformation.

 

Plastic Metal: Warehousing

 

WEICON Plastic Metals must be stored at room temperature (max. 25°C) in a dry place. Sealed containers may be stored for a maximum of 24 months after delivery at temperatures between +18°C and +25°C (the Pasty Epoxy Resin max 36 months).

 

Opened containers must be used within 6 months.
